Just for background sake, I originally started up my Pokerstars account with $50 determined to maintain and build that up to a respectable amount. I'm currently at $155 and while the progress hasn't gone as fast as I originally hoped, I am happy that I'm at least showing a profit.

My best money maker at the moment is a new 8-game Sit & Go tournament that Pokerstars added. This is a 6-person tournament with a $3.30 buy-in that pays the top 2 places. I currently have a very high cash rate in these tournaments. At the levels that I play, the players just do not seem to play the games very well. The games included are 2-7 triple draw, limit hold'em, Omaha 8, Razz, Stud, Stud 8, No Limit Hold'em, and Pot Limit Omaha. I just love this tournament. It has so many different games and also different betting structures that I think it could be a long term profit maker for me.
